Quote:
Originally Posted by hotrods1795 View Post

My understanding is that the diaper does not have to be SFI approved, can be homemade, just so you have somthing to catch the oil and does not have to be fire proof. What if I have a small leak (that I am not aware of), have a diaper on and since the diapers are not fireproof, the leak could soak the diaper and cause a fire due to hot headers, etc.

Danny Henderson
SS/GA 1795
You are right about it not having to be SFI approved for most classes (classes requiring SFI diapers are spelled out in the rule book under class requirements) but it does have to be NHRA approved, (list can be found on nhraracer.com )So your homemade diaper idea will not fly.
